Output 69dcd94f294d05cb2f2610568659ccfe328897670f939442abd5d19b511d7259:0

value
20048632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04247f9850a1ad2425dc5e44f84e658368e8147 OP_EQUAL
address
3LgBsjrFuzgU1BoWHNfkgDSZDouec9a4vR
transaction
69dcd94f294d05cb2f2610568659ccfe328897670f939442abd5d19b511d7259
confirmations
57932
spent
true